Ladysmith Black Mambazo Founder Joseph Tshabalala’s Shocking Health Scare

It has been reported that the founder of the Legendary sicathamiya band Ladysmith Black Mambazo, Joseph Tshabalala is currently going through another health scare in his retirement.

The 76 year old has gone through a spinal surgery after being admitted to hospital back in July when he was struggling to get on his feet. Speaking to TshisaLive one of the member Sandile Khumalo said that his condition had gotten worse.

“He has been discharged and is recovering at home but is still struggling. He is old now. We were worried when he went in for the operation, and are still very concerned because he is sick, but he is getting stronger,” Said Sandile. Joseph has been experiencing these health conditions ever since he retired back in April he was visited by President Jacob Zuma in hospital. The group is now in the hands of his son Sbongiseni Tshabalala.

KZN MEC Sibongiseni Dhlomo arranged for a musician to be attended to by specialists from Inkosi Albert Luthuli Hospital to treat the him when his condition got worse.
